Biography

Heather MacLean is a Professor in the Department of Civil and Mineral Engineering at the University of Toronto. Her research focuses on the fields of energy and resources management, as well as sustainable design and technology. Dr. MacLean is committed to advancing knowledge in the areas of environmental sustainability and public policy related to natural resources. She has contributed significantly to the understanding of the interplay between engineering practices and environmental impacts, working to integrate sustainable principles into engineering solutions. Through her work, Professor MacLean aims to foster innovation that addresses pressing global challenges, leveraging her expertise to inform better decision-making processes in civil and mineral engineering contexts.
